Weather Vane, c. 1941 - A Timeless Symbol of American Heritage
EDITORS COMMENTS
. This print showcases the exquisite craftsmanship and artistic vision of Elmer K Kottcamp's "Weather Vane". Created in the early 1940s, this piece stands as a testament to the rich cultural heritage of America during that era. The artwork depicts a majestic rooster perched atop a weather vane, its vibrant colors and intricate details brought to life through watercolor and graphite on paper. The cockerel's proud stance symbolizes resilience and strength, while its compass point design represents direction and adaptability in changing times. As we gaze upon this remarkable creation, we are transported back to a simpler time when rural landscapes dominated the country. This charming bird serves not only as an ornamental object but also as a functional tool for predicting weather patterns - an essential aspect of daily life in those days. Preserved within the National Gallery of Art's collection, this masterpiece is part of the Index of American Design series that celebrates iconic pieces from various regions across the United States.
